Understanding the App Download Process

Before we dive into the reasons behind slow app downloads, it’s essential to understand how the app download process works. When you initiate an app download from an app store, such as the Apple App Store or Google Play Store, the following steps occur:

  • The app store server receives your request and verifies your account and device information.
  • The server then sends the app’s metadata, including its size, version, and download link, to your device.
  • Your device connects to the download link and starts downloading the app’s files.
  • The app’s files are stored on your device, and the app is installed.

Factors Affecting App Download Speed

Several factors can impact app download speed, including:

  • Internet Connection Speed: A slow internet connection is the most common reason for slow app downloads. If your internet connection is slow, it will take longer to download the app’s files.
  • App Size: Larger apps take longer to download, especially if you have a slow internet connection.
  • Server Load: If the app store server is experiencing high traffic or technical issues, it can slow down the download process.
  • Device Hardware: The processing power and storage capacity of your device can also impact app download speed.
  • Network Congestion: If multiple devices are connected to the same network and downloading apps simultaneously, it can cause network congestion and slow down the download process.

Internet Connection Speed: The Primary Culprit

Internet connection speed is the primary factor affecting app download speed. A slow internet connection can be caused by various factors, including:

  • Distance from the Wi-Fi Router: The farther you are from the Wi-Fi router, the weaker the signal and the slower the internet connection.
  • Number of Devices Connected: The more devices connected to the same network, the slower the internet connection.
  • Internet Service Provider (ISP): Your ISP’s infrastructure and network capacity can impact your internet connection speed.
  • Physical Barriers: Physical barriers, such as walls and floors, can weaken the Wi-Fi signal and slow down the internet connection.

How does internet connection speed impact app download times?

Internet connection speed plays a significant role in determining app download times. A faster internet connection can significantly reduce download times, while a slow connection can lead to frustratingly long waits. The speed of the internet connection is measured in megabits per second (Mbps) or gigabits per second (Gbps), and it can vary greatly depending on the type of connection, such as Wi-Fi, 4G, or 5G.

For example, if a user has a 100 Mbps internet connection, they can expect to download a 100 MB app in around 8 seconds. However, if the same user has a 10 Mbps connection, the download time would increase to around 80 seconds. Therefore, it is essential to have a stable and fast internet connection to ensure quick and seamless app downloads.

What role does server response time play in app download speeds?

Server response time is another critical factor that affects app download speeds. When a user requests to download an app, the request is sent to the server, which then responds with the app’s data. The time it takes for the server to respond can significantly impact the overall download time. A slow server response time can lead to delayed downloads, while a fast response time can speed up the process.

Server response time is influenced by various factors, including the server’s hardware, software, and network infrastructure. Additionally, the server’s workload and the number of concurrent requests it receives can also impact its response time. Developers can optimize server response times by using content delivery networks (CDNs), caching, and load balancing techniques.

How does network congestion affect app download speeds?

Network congestion occurs when a large number of users are connected to the same network, causing a surge in data traffic. This can lead to slow app download speeds, as the network becomes overwhelmed with requests. Network congestion can be caused by various factors, including peak usage hours, limited network bandwidth, and poor network infrastructure.

When a network is congested, it can take longer for data packets to be transmitted, leading to delayed downloads. To mitigate this issue, developers can use techniques such as traffic shaping, quality of service (QoS), and network optimization. Additionally, users can try downloading apps during off-peak hours or using a different network to avoid congestion.
